On Monday morning, June 25, a man was transported from the scene of an accident with a possible head injury after he crashed his vehicle at Macon County Veterinary Hospital.

According to Tennessee Highway Patrol at the scene, 21-year-old Kyle Hall was traveling east on Highway 52 when he left the roadway and struck at drain culvert at the driveway of the veterinary hospital, which is located at 2586 Highway 52.

After striking the culvert, Hall traveled through a field beside the veterinary hospital and struck the corner of a building located beside the main building.

He came to final rest after striking wooden corral gates at the rear of the main building used to examine large animals.

Hall was transported from the scene by Macon County EMS and later flown to Vanderbilt Medical Center.
